Today (29 september) is the birth anniversary of Ravi Baswani (September 29, 1946 – July 27, 2010). Ravi Baswani made his debut as a comedian in 1980s and he acted in some lovely comedy movies of that era, viz “Jaane Bhi Do Yaaron”, “Peechha Karo” etc.

Today (27 september) is the birthday of not one but two birthdays in the Chopra family of movie producers and directors. In addition to Yash Chopra, today is the birthday of Ravi Chopra (son of B R Chopra) as well, who was born this day in 1946.

“Naache Mayuri”(1986)” was a Hindi remake of the Telugu “Mayuri”(1984). These movies were based on the real life story of Sudha Chandran. Sudha Chandran, a dancing enthusiast, had lost one leg in an accident. But she braved all odds and used artifical limb (prosthetic ‘Jaipur foot’) and continued to pursue her first love viz. dancing and became a leading dancer. She was invited to perform in India as well as abroad. Her fame spread and she got offers to work in movies. Telugu movie “Mayuri” (1984) was made on her own life. This movie became a big success at the box office. It was subsequently dubbed into Malayalam and Telugu with the same title. Later on, this movie was remade into Hindi as “Naache Mayuri” (1986).
